如何使用skeleton建造网页

使用skeleton建造网页非常简单高效。首先,下载并引入skeleton的CSS和JS文件。接着,利用其预设的网格系统布局页面,通过类名如‘row’和‘column’快速搭建结构。skeleton提供简洁的响应式设计,确保网页在不同设备上表现一致。最后,通过自定义样式完善细节,快速实现美观且功能完善的网页。

imagesource from: pexels

如何使用Skeleton建造网页——引言

在现代网页开发领域,Skeleton框架以其简单易用和高效性,成为了众多开发者青睐的工具。作为一个响应式网格框架,Skeleton能够帮助我们快速搭建网页的基本结构,节省了大量的时间与精力。本文将为您详细介绍Skeleton框架的基本概念及其在网页开发中的优势,激发您对使用Skeleton建造网页的兴趣。在这里,您将了解到如何利用Skeleton的强大功能,实现美观且功能完善的网页。

一、Skeleton框架简介

1、什么是Skeleton

Skeleton是一个轻量级的框架,专为前端网页开发设计。它提供了一套预设的网格系统,可以帮助开发者快速搭建网页的基本结构,同时保持布局的一致性和响应式设计。Skeleton的核心是简洁性,通过预定义的CSS类和简单的JavaScript,开发者可以迅速构建出美观且高效的网页。

2、Skeleton的主要特点

  • 简单易用:Skeleton提供了简单直观的语法和类名,即使是初学者也能快速上手。
  • 响应式设计:内置的网格系统支持响应式设计,确保网页在不同设备上均有良好的显示效果。
  • 跨浏览器兼容:Skeleton兼容主流浏览器,减少了开发过程中的兼容性问题。
  • 轻量级:框架本身体积小,加快了网页加载速度。
  • 自定义性强:开发者可以根据需求自定义样式,满足个性化设计需求。

二、快速上手Skeleton

1、下载并引入Skeleton文件

要开始使用Skeleton,首先需要从其官方网站(https://getSkeleton.org/)下载CSS和JavaScript文件。将下载的CSS文件链接到你的HTML文档中,以便应用其样式。同样,将JavaScript文件也引入到HTML文档中,以便使用Skeleton的功能。

            使用Skeleton建造网页            

2、使用预设网格系统布局页面

Skeleton提供了一套预设的网格系统,使用类名rowcolumn可以快速搭建页面结构。下面是一个简单的例子:

这里是第一列的内容
这里是第二列的内容
这里是第三列的内容

在上述代码中,.container 类定义了页面的最大宽度,.row 类表示一行,而.columns 类定义了列的宽度。通过组合这些类名,你可以轻松创建出不同列数的布局。

3、利用类名‘row’和‘column’搭建结构

除了预设的网格系统, Skeleton还提供了丰富的其他类名,以帮助搭建各种布局。以下是一些常见的类名:

类名 说明
.offset-x columns 将列从左边偏移 x 个单位宽度,其中 x 为数字或百分比
.push-x columns 将列从左边偏移到指定位置,x 为数字或百分比
.pull-x columns 将列从右边拉到指定位置,x 为数字或百分比
.hidden-xs 在移动设备上隐藏元素
.visible-xs 在移动设备上显示元素

通过使用这些类名,你可以快速搭建出各种响应式布局,并满足不同的设计需求。

总结来说,Skeleton是一款简单易用的框架,可以帮助你快速搭建出美观且功能完善的网页。通过下载文件、使用预设网格系统、以及利用丰富的类名,你可以轻松上手并开始构建自己的网页。

三、实现响应式设计

1、Skeleton的响应式设计原理

在当前多终端的互联网时代,响应式设计已成为网页开发的重要趋势。Skeleton框架通过CSS媒体查询和百分比布局,实现了网页在不同设备上的自适应显示。其响应式设计原理如下:

  • 媒体查询:根据不同设备的屏幕尺寸,通过CSS媒体查询对网页元素进行样式调整。
  • 百分比布局:使用百分比而非固定像素值进行布局,确保元素在不同设备上按照比例缩放。

2、确保网页在不同设备上的表现一致

为了确保网页在不同设备上的表现一致,我们可以采取以下措施:

  • 使用Skeleton提供的网格系统:利用预设的网格系统进行布局,确保网页元素在不同设备上保持一致。
  • 调整媒体查询:针对不同设备,调整媒体查询中的样式规则,优化页面布局。
  • 测试与优化:使用多种设备测试网页,发现问题并及时优化。

以下是一个简单的表格,展示了不同设备下的媒体查询规则:

设备类型 媒体查询 样式规则
手机 @media (max-width: 768px) 调整字体大小、布局等
平板 @media (min-width: 768px) and (max-width: 992px) 调整字体大小、布局等
电脑 @media (min-width: 992px) 调整字体大小、布局等

通过以上措施,我们可以确保使用Skeleton框架开发的网页在不同设备上具有良好的响应式表现。

四、自定义样式与细节完善

1. 如何自定义样式

在掌握了Skeleton的基本用法后,下一步便是根据个人或项目需求进行样式定制。自定义样式可以大大提升网页的整体视觉效果,使其更符合品牌风格或个人喜好。以下是自定义样式的几个关键步骤:

  • 引入自定义CSS文件:在HTML文件中,通过标签引入自定义的CSS文件。
  • 修改或覆盖默认样式:在自定义CSS中,可以直接修改或覆盖Skeleton的默认样式。例如,你可以通过修改.row.column类的宽度和间距来改变布局。
  • 添加新样式:根据需要添加新的样式,比如按钮、表单、图片等元素的样式。

以下是一个简单的自定义样式的例子:

/* 自定义CSS文件 */.row {  margin: 0 -15px; /* 调整间距 */}.column {  padding: 15px; /* 调整填充 */}.button {  background-color: #3498db; /* 按钮背景色 */  color: white; /* 按钮文字颜色 */}

2. 常见细节优化技巧

为了使网页更加美观和实用,以下是一些常见的细节优化技巧:

  • 使用响应式图片:确保图片在不同设备上清晰显示,可以使用CSS的background-size: cover;属性。
  • 优化字体加载:使用Web字体加载策略,如@font-face,确保字体在不同设备上平滑显示。
  • 添加动画效果:使用CSS3动画或JavaScript动画,提升用户体验。

以下是一个使用CSS3动画的例子:

.animation {  animation: slideIn 2s infinite;}@keyframes slideIn {  0% {    transform: translateX(-100%);  }  100% {    transform: translateX(0);  }}

通过以上步骤,你可以轻松地自定义Skeleton的样式,并在细节上进行优化,打造出符合需求的网页。

结语:Skeleton——高效网页开发的最佳选择

总结来说,Skeleton框架凭借其简单易用、高效性以及响应式设计的优势,已经成为网页开发者的不二选择。通过本篇文章的介绍,相信读者已经对如何使用Skeleton建造网页有了全面的了解。无论是新手还是资深开发者,Skeleton都能帮助你们快速搭建出美观且功能完善的网页。展望未来,随着网页开发技术的不断进步,Skeleton框架有望在更多的项目中发挥其重要作用。让我们一起期待,Skeleton在未来网页开发中的更多精彩表现!

常见问题

1、Skeleton支持哪些浏览器?

Skeleton框架兼容主流浏览器,包括Chrome、Firefox、Safari、Edge以及IE9及以上版本。这使得开发者可以放心地在多种设备上使用Skeleton构建网页,无需过多考虑浏览器兼容性问题。

2、如何解决Skeleton布局中的兼容性问题?

尽管Skeleton框架兼容性较好,但在某些情况下仍可能遇到兼容性问题。解决方法如下:

  • 检查CSS代码:确保使用的CSS属性和选择器在目标浏览器中有效。
  • 使用polyfills:对于不支持某些CSS属性的浏览器,可以使用polyfills进行弥补。
  • 针对特定浏览器编写代码:针对某些特定浏览器编写额外的CSS代码,以确保布局的一致性。

3、Skeleton与其他前端框架相比有何优势?

与其他前端框架相比,Skeleton具有以下优势:

  • 简单易用:Skeleton的语法简洁,易于学习和使用。
  • 高效开发:预设的网格系统和响应式设计功能,大大提高了开发效率。
  • 跨平台兼容:兼容主流浏览器和设备,确保网页在各种环境下都能正常显示。

4、新手如何快速上手Skeleton?

对于新手来说,快速上手Skeleton的方法如下:

  1. 了解Skeleton的基本概念和原理
  2. 下载并引入Skeleton的CSS和JS文件
  3. 利用预设的网格系统布局页面
  4. 通过类名如‘row’和‘column’搭建结构
  5. 学习自定义样式,完善细节

遵循以上步骤,新手可以快速掌握Skeleton的使用方法,并开始构建自己的网页。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/75874.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-13 20:57
Next 2025-06-13 20:57

相关推荐

  • 什么商品适合外贸

    选择适合外贸的商品需考虑市场需求、竞争程度和产品特性。电子消费品、时尚服饰和家居装饰品因其高需求和利润空间,通常是理想选择。确保产品质量符合国际标准,并做好市场调研,了解目标市场的消费习惯和文化差异。

    2025-06-19
    0101
  • 锚文本如何设置

    设置锚文本时,首先选择具有相关性和高搜索量的关键词。将关键词嵌入到自然流畅的句子中,确保锚文本与链接页面内容高度相关。避免过度优化和关键词堆砌,保持用户体验良好。使用多样化的锚文本形式,如短语、句子等,以提高搜索引擎的友好度。

  • 网站如何添加关键词

    要为网站添加关键词,首先进行关键词研究,找出与内容相关的热门词汇。然后在网站的标题标签、元描述、正文内容、URL和图片alt标签中自然融入这些关键词。确保关键词分布合理,避免堆砌。最后,使用SEO工具如Google Keyword Planner进行优化和监测。

    2025-06-09
    011
  • 阿里云服务器怎么迁移

    阿里云服务器迁移可以通过以下步骤完成:首先,备份数据以防丢失;其次,在新服务器上创建相同配置的环境;然后,使用阿里云提供的迁移工具或第三方工具将数据迁移到新服务器;最后,验证数据完整性和应用功能。注意更新DNS解析记录,确保业务无缝切换。

    2025-06-10
    01
  • 婚庆网站如何推广

    婚庆网站推广首先要优化网站SEO,选择与婚庆相关的关键词,如“婚礼策划”、“婚纱摄影”等,确保内容高质量且频繁更新。利用社交媒体平台发布婚礼案例、攻略,吸引目标用户。合作婚庆相关KOL进行内容营销,提升品牌知名度。同时,参与线下婚博会等活动,获取精准客户。

    2025-06-13
    0344
  • 什么是限制网站吗

    限制网站是指通过技术手段或政策规定,对特定网站的内容访问进行限制的行为。常见原因包括版权保护、内容审查、网络安全等。用户可能会遇到无法访问某些网站的情况,企业也可能因政策限制影响业务发展。了解限制网站的原因和应对方法,有助于提高网络使用效率和安全性。

    2025-06-20
    085
  • 众诺信息技术怎么样

    众诺信息技术凭借其强大的技术实力和丰富的行业经验,赢得了市场的广泛认可。公司专注于提供高效的信息技术解决方案,帮助企业提升运营效率。其专业团队和优质服务,确保了项目的成功实施,客户满意度高。

    2025-06-17
    0101
  • 公司网站如何创造收益

    提升公司网站收益,关键在于优化用户体验和SEO排名。通过高质量内容吸引流量,利用关键词研究和内链策略提高搜索引擎可见度。同时,增设在线咨询、产品展示和会员系统等功能,促进转化。定期分析数据,调整策略,确保持续盈利。

    2025-06-13
    0442
  • 注册域名如何注册

    注册域名首先选择可靠注册商,如阿里云、腾讯云。访问其官网,搜索心仪域名,确认可用后加入购物车。填写注册信息,包括个人信息和DNS设置。支付费用后,域名即可注册成功。注意选择.com等常见后缀,便于记忆和SEO优化。

    2025-06-13
    0291

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注